Output 80ddac08610da227821b21a58b96011072dd1e362f1a6304c28863cd4eee370b:0

value
3035047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a8e5a3aa855f64b682b7c264328489faf82a081 OP_EQUAL
address
3EKdhqaxzNUmmGwhz6rK7VWBsZ868pKanZ
transaction
80ddac08610da227821b21a58b96011072dd1e362f1a6304c28863cd4eee370b
spent
true